Are warm-ups at Military Park or in the stadium lot? When do warm ups typically begin?

Thanks

Usually the battery and hornlines warmup at military park, and the pit warms up on the opposite side of the stadium from the main entrance. My guess is they get there an hour and a half to two hours before their performance time. I'm pretty sure on that one, I've seen a lot of stuff in the lot this year. Including prelims and semis.
